Two American Airlines-owned regional carriers will hike pilot pay by 50% through the end of August 2024, the latest sign airlines are willing to pay up in hopes of ending a pilot shortage that has left some travelers with fewer flight options. According to an internal memo, FedEx to no longer require pilots to have a 4-year degree to apply, and hire 70 pilots per month for the "foreseeable future". The Allied Pilots Associationrequestedthat American Airlines find alternate means of compliance with the Executive Order be made available for professional pilots so as not to prompt mass firings and unpaid leave following President Joe Bidens Septemberannouncement mandating large employers to require vaccinations or weekly testing. The Allied Pilots Association says about 30% of American's 14,000 pilots have not gotten shots and warns that mass terminations of unvaccinated pilots could lead to a severe shortage of.
